Modesto, May 16, 2025 -

A traffic collision involving three vehicles occurred today at the intersection of Albers Road and Claribel Road in Modesto, CA. The incident took place around 8:10 AM during the morning commute, involving a white Dodge pickup, a red Chevrolet, and a Ford F25.

The California Highway Patrol responded quickly, dispatching multiple units to the scene to manage traffic and ensure safety. As a result of the collision, traffic disruptions were reported, leading to lane closures and congestion in the area. Emergency responders worked diligently to control the situation and clear the roadway.

By approximately 8:56 AM, a tow truck arrived to assist with the removal of the vehicles involved in the crash. CHP units were actively directing traffic to minimize delays and restore normal flow as efficiently as possible.
